Rekeying locks

You can call an expert locksmith if you've locked your keys in your car or have lost them. They can take the lock apart and replace the pins. They can also reset the locks to ensure that they can be operated with an alternative key. This is usually a cheaper alternative to replacing the lock, and it also gives you a sense security. It is essential to inquire with the locksmith what the service will cost before you hire them. Some companies charge higher fees while others offer discounts on certain services.

It is logical to rekey your locks after moving into a new house. This will ensure that the only key that works is yours and no one else can access your property. It is also a good idea in the event that you suspect someone has robbed or copied your keys.

Rekeying is cheaper than replacing locks and doesn't impact the quality of the lock. In fact, it is quite secure because only the key that is compatible with the rekeyed lock will open it. A professional locksmith can rekey your locks in no time. If you want to change the locks on your home, you should replace them all.

It is more expensive to replace a lock rather than to rekey it, however, you may need to do this in the event that your lock is damaged or if you've lost the original key. It is a great way to add more security to your home, especially when you have multiple doors that share the same lock.

After a break-in, or theft, it's recommended to have your locks rekeyed. This will stop future incidents, and give you peace of mind. You can even change the locks on your home to match the locks in other homes.

Car key replacement

Car key replacement is the process of replacing a lost car key or one that is damaged. It involves cutting the new blank and programming it to match your vehicle's computer system. This is a complicated job that requires special equipment and training. The type of key you use and the make of the vehicle are two of the factors that can affect the cost. If your car is a more recent model it will be more expensive than older models. There are two kinds of keys: a mechanical key that unlocks and locks your car, and remote start keys that allows you to lock and start the car from a distance. The price of the key will also depend on whether it comes with a transponder chip.

Key Extraction

When your key breaks inside the lock, it could be a huge hassle. This could also put your home at risk of theft, and make it difficult to lock the doors when you're out. Luckily, a locksmith can handle this problem without causing damage to the lock or door. They have specialized tools and methods to help you get the broken piece of your lock, and it's worth calling them if you require assistance in an emergency.

You can try a few DIY methods to recover the door key that is broken. For instance, you could make use of a pair needle-nose pliers or a magnet to grab the broken piece of key and then pull it out. This method only works if you can still see a significant amount of the key in the lock. In the event that you fail, you could push the break-off piece further into the lock, causing more damage.

Another alternative is to use a jigsaw blade to remove the broken key fragment from the lock. It is best to do this in a bright area. However it is crucial to use a thin blade. This will reduce friction between the blades and the lock, and help in removing the fragment. A lubrication can also reduce friction.

Car key programming

Car key programming is the process of reprogramming an existing blank chip in a new or replacement car key or fob in order that it is compatible with the current configurations of the vehicle. To be successful, it requires advanced tools and extensive training. It is therefore essential to engage a professional complete the task. The price for this service will vary depending on the type of key or fob and the type of signal it has. Keys older than this have simpler signals that can be gathered by a remote key copying device. Newer smart keys, however, use encrypted signals which are more difficult to discern.

Contrary to the older mechanical keys modern car keys have transponder chips that connect to your vehicle's computer system to allow it to start. Key fobs like these can be an incredible convenience, but they're also more expensive to replace than traditional keys. This is because they need to be programmed by an auto key fob locksmith near me dealer or locksmith in order to work.

A new key fob or a replacement key is usually going to cost you $100-$150, including the cost of the blank key as well as cutting. In some cases keys, there may be an electronic circuit inside which needs to be replaced as well, which can add another $50-$100 to the cost of the job.
